This feature analyzed file usage patterns. It placed frequently accessed files at the faster outer tracks of the disk and rarely used files on the slower inner tracks.

Certain system files, such as the Windows Page File, Hibernation File, and system registry hives, are locked while the operating system is running. PerfectDisk Pro 12.5 offered a boot-time defragmentation mode. This ran before the GUI loaded, allowing the utility to safely defragment and optimize these critical system files.
